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 214580 - media-gfx/splashutils-1.5.4-r1 build fails
Summary: media-gfx/splashutils-1.5.4-r1 build fails
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: Michal Januszewski (RETIRED)
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2008-03-24 19:14 UTC by Gabriel Devenyi
Modified: 2008-03-25 09:01 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Gabriel Devenyi 2008-03-24 19:14:12 UTC
make -j3 LIB=lib
cc -O2 -march=prescott -pipe -fomit-frame-pointer -g -Wall -I../core/objs -I../core -I../core/src -I../core/objs/src -fPIC -c -o splash.o splash.c
splash.c: In function 'strlist_merge_sort':
splash.c:66: warning: implicit declaration of function 'rc_strlist_addsort'
splash.c: In function 'get_list_fp':
splash.c:112: warning: implicit declaration of function 'rc_strlist_add'
splash.c: In function 'splash_config_gentoo':
splash.c:146: warning: assignment from incompatible pointer type
splash.c:148: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:157: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:163: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:171: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:175: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:186: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:192: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:198: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:205: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:211: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:217: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:222: warning: passing argument 1 of 'rc_config_value' from incompatible pointer type
splash.c:235: warning: implicit declaration of function 'rc_strlist_free'
splash.c: In function 'splash_init':
splash.c:374: warning: assignment from incompatible pointer type
splash.c:376: warning: assignment from incompatible pointer type
splash.c:380: warning: assignment from incompatible pointer type
splash.c:384: warning: assignment from incompatible pointer type
splash.c:394: warning: assignment from incompatible pointer type
splash.c:396: warning: assignment from incompatible pointer type
splash.c:400: warning: assignment from incompatible pointer type
splash.c: In function 'splash_svcs_start':
splash.c:448: error: 'rc_depinfo_t' undeclared (first use in this function)
splash.c:448: error: (Each undeclared identifier is reported only once
splash.c:448: error: for each function it appears in.)
splash.c:448: error: 'deptree' undeclared (first use in this function)
splash.c:465: warning: assignment from incompatible pointer type
splash.c:478: warning: assignment from incompatible pointer type
splash.c: In function 'splash_svcs_stop':
splash.c:509: error: 'rc_depinfo_t' undeclared (first use in this function)
splash.c:509: error: 'deptree' undeclared (first use in this function)
splash.c:526: warning: assignment from incompatible pointer type
splash.c: At top level:
splash.c:643: error: expected ')' before 'hook'
make: *** [splash.o] Error 1

!!! ERROR in media-gfx/splashutils-1.5.4-r1:
!!! In src_compile at line 3384
!!! failed to build the splash plugin

!!! Call stack:
!!!    * src_compile (/var/tmp/paludis/media-gfx/splashutils-1.5.4-r1/temp/loadsaveenv:3384)
!!!    * ebuild_f_compile (/usr/libexec/paludis/1/src_compile.bash:49)
!!!    * ebuild_main (/usr/libexec/paludis/ebuild.bash:462)
!!!    * main (/usr/libexec/paludis/ebuild.bash:480)

diefunc: making ebuild PID 7236 exit with error
die trap: exiting with error.

Install error:
  * In program /usr/bin/paludis --dl-reinstall if-use-changed --show-reasons summary --log-level warning --debug-build none --continue-on-failure if-independent --dl-reinstall-scm daily -i splashutils:
  * When performing install action from command line:
  * When executing install task:
  * When installing 'media-gfx/splashutils-1.5.4-r1:0::gentoo':
  * Install error: Install failed for 'media-gfx/splashutils-1.5.4-r1:0::gentoo'

paludis --info
paludis 0.26.0_alpha13
Paludis build information:
    Compiler:
        CXX:                   i686-pc-linux-gnu-g++ 4.1.2 (Gentoo 4.1.2)
        CXXFLAGS:              -O2 -march=prescott -pipe -fomit-frame-pointer
        LDFLAGS:               -Wl,-O1 -Wl,--as-needed
        DATE:                  2008-03-24T10:00:07-0400

    Libraries:
        C++ Library:           GNU libstdc++ 20070214

    Reduced Privs:
        reduced_uid:           106
        reduced_uid->name:     paludisbuild
        reduced_uid->dir:      /dev/null
        reduced_gid:           1005
        reduced_gid->name:     paludisbuild

    Paths:
        DATADIR:               /usr/share
        LIBDIR:                /usr/lib
        LIBEXECDIR:            /usr/libexec
        SYSCONFDIR:            /etc
        PYTHONINSTALLDIR:      /usr/lib/python2.5/site-packages
        RUBYINSTALLDIR:        /usr/lib/ruby/site_ruby/1.8/i686-linux

Repository virtuals:
    format:                    virtuals

Repository installed-virtuals:
    format:                    installed_virtuals
    root:                      /

Repository gentoo:
    format:                    ebuild
    location:                  /usr/portage
    append_repository_name_to_write_cache: true
    binary_destination:        false
    binary_keywords:
    binary_uri_prefix:
    builddir:                  /var/tmp/paludis
    cache:                     /usr/portage/metadata/cache
    distdir:                   /usr/portage/distfiles
    eapi_when_unknown:         0
    eapi_when_unspecified:     0
    eclassdirs:                /usr/portage/eclass
    ignore_deprecated_profiles: false
    layout:                    traditional
    names_cache:               /usr/portage/.cache/names
    newsdir:                   /usr/portage/metadata/news
    profile_eapi:              0
    profiles:                  /usr/portage/profiles/default-linux/x86/2007.0
    securitydir:               /usr/portage/metadata/glsa
    setsdir:                   /usr/portage/sets
    sync:                      rsync://rsync.gentoo.org/gentoo-portage
    sync_options:
    use_manifest:              use
    write_cache:               /var/cache/paludis/metadata

    Package information:
        app-admin/eselect-compiler: (none)
        app-shells/bash:       3.2_p33
        dev-java/java-config:  1.3.7 2.1.5
        dev-lang/python:       2.4.4-r5 2.5.1-r5
        dev-python/pycrypto:   2.0.1-r6
        dev-util/ccache:       2.4-r7
        dev-util/confcache:    (none)
        sys-apps/baselayout:   2.0.0
        sys-apps/sandbox:      1.2.18.1-r2
        sys-devel/autoconf:    2.13 2.61-r1
        sys-devel/automake:    1.10.1 1.5 1.6.3 1.7.9-r1 1.8.5-r3 1.9.6-r2
        sys-devel/binutils:    2.18-r1
        sys-devel/gcc-config:  1.4.0-r4
        sys-devel/libtool:     1.5.26
        virtual/os-headers:    2.6.24 (for sys-kernel/linux-headers::installed)
Comment 1 Michal Januszewski (RETIRED) gentoo-dev 2008-03-25 09:01:44 UTC
This should now be fixed in CVS.